If you want them and don’t have them, your under dash wiring harness has to be slightly modified to make them work.
So you have to be comfortable doing that. And you have to keep in mind if they get damaged in any way that is beyond your acceptable cosmetic appearance or you just want to return to stock, you have to un-do the wiring mod to make reds work again.
This isn’t a swap n be done mod.
Indeed, some steps:
1) You need the Amber harness. You can also make a new one out of the non Amber mustangs.
2) 12-14 gauge wires to connect the amber harness to the stock harness (if Ambers came with their harness).
3) You will need an EP-27 flasher. Easily found at your nearest autoparts store. The flasher will get rid of the rapid flashing when using the turning signals. Another benefit is that you can drop LED signal bulbs without getting the hyper flashing.
4) You will need to interrupt the constant brake signal. If you don’t, every time you hit the brakes, the amber bulbs will light up. The Plug where this constant brake signal cable is located is under the dash. I had to drop the steering column to gain access to the plug and cable. I’ve heard of people doing the same with a plug behind the kick panel. With this method you won’t need to drop the steering column. Alas, I’ve heard mixed results from the kick panel method, for some worked and for some did not.
